A Game-Changing 4WD System
At the heart of the demonstration was the GWM Hi4 (Hybrid Intelligent 4WD) system, which leverages a dual-motor hybrid architecture (P2 front motor + P4 rear motor) to intelligently distribute power between the front and rear axles. Unlike conventional 4WD systems that often sacrifice fuel economy for traction and capability, Hi4 balances both ends of the spectrum.
The result is an intelligent drive system that allows vehicles to operate with the strength and control of 4WD while consuming energy closer to that of 2WD. For consumers, this means fewer compromises: you can have rugged performance without worrying about soaring fuel costs.

Precision Handling and Driving Pleasure
Beyond efficiency, the Hi4 system excels in driving dynamics. GWM’s iTVC (intelligent torque vectoring control) adds a layer of responsiveness and agility. When cornering, the system precisely calibrates torque distribution so that the rear axle powers the entry, while the front axle ensures a balanced and stable exit.

Safety Across All Terrains
Safety is one of the most critical aspects of modern automotive design, and GWM has ensured that Hi4-equipped vehicles excel in this area. On wet asphalt, muddy trails, or loose gravel roads, the iTVC system performs millisecond-level torque adjustments to maintain stability and prevent slippage.
During the Dujiangyan test drive, journalists also had the chance to push the TANK 500 Hi4-T to its limits in off-road scenarios. Equipped with mechanical 4WD and three locking differentials, the SUV demonstrated extraordinary resilience. Even in situations where only one wheel maintained ground contact, the vehicle preserved 100% torque output to maintain forward momentum.

Expanding to Global Markets
GWM is not limiting the benefits of Hi4 technology to China. Models such as the HAVAL H6, WEY G9, and the TANK 300, 500, and 700 are poised to enter international markets. Countries including Australia, Pakistan, South Africa, Malaysia, Thailand, Brazil, and Kazakhstan will soon welcome Hi4-equipped vehicles to their showrooms.
